Silicone rubber heaters are critical in medical equipment sterilization due to their flexibility, durability, and precise temperature control.

Here are key applications where they play a vital role:
Used to maintain consistent chamber temperatures for effective steam sterilization.
Ensure even heat distribution to eliminate pathogens (bacteria, viruses, spores).
Provide uniform heating for ovens that sterilize moisture-sensitive instruments (e.g., glassware, metal tools).
Operate at high temperatures (160°C–190°C) without degrading.
Heat tubing and fluid lines in dialysis machines, endoscopes, or surgical tools to prevent biofilm formation.
Resist chemicals used in cleaning (e.g., hydrogen peroxide, ethylene oxide).
Maintain sterile solutions, blankets, or surgical instruments at controlled temperatures before use.
Lightweight and adaptable for field-use sterilizers in mobile medical units or emergency settings.
Chemical Resistance: Withstand harsh sterilants (e.g., EtO, bleach).
Flexibility: Conform to complex shapes (e.g., curved surfaces, joints).
Fast Response: Enable rapid heating/cooling cycles for efficiency.
Safety: Electrically insulated and compliant with medical standards (ISO 13485, FDA).
